Fogg Dam Conservation Reserve, NT
Fogg Dam Conservation Reserve is only a 20 minute drive from the Humpty Doo area and we went there at least once a week during our stay in the top end.
The reserve was full of birds (and some crocodiles) and there were two walking trails plus a lookout platform overlooking the flooded plain.
On most visits we would walk both the trails (Monsoon Forest Walk – 4.5km return, and Woodlands to Waterlilies Walk – 2km return) and then drive over the dam to the lookout area.
It was forbidden to walk across the dam because of the danger of crocodiles?!
